Career path

Career Role (Marine Instrumentation Design Specialist) Description
Senior Marine Instrumentation Engineer Leads complex projects, manages teams, and ensures compliance with industry standards in marine instrumentation design. High demand for experience in underwater technology and sensor integration.
Marine Instrumentation Technician Installs, calibrates, maintains, and repairs marine instrumentation systems. Requires practical skills and knowledge of various sensors and control systems. Strong job market.
Marine Electronics and Instrumentation Specialist Focuses on the design, integration, and troubleshooting of electronic systems within marine instrumentation. Expertise in navigation, communication, and automation systems is crucial. Growing demand.
Subsea Instrumentation Engineer Specialises in the design and deployment of instrumentation for underwater applications. Requires knowledge of ROVs, AUVs, and deep-sea environments. High earning potential.
